> Today's mass media is better, in terms of adherence to the truth, diversity, and creativity than at any point in time.

I'm not sure how you would go about backing up a statement like this. It doesn't pass the eye test to me.

I think you could definitely say that mass media is bigger, and within it there are pockets of excellent journalism that have the features you describe.

But these standouts are far too easily drowned in a glut of misinformation, editorializing, listicles, and so on. And so it becomes really easy to dismiss 'the media' when 'the media' is far from a homogeneous industry. Even certain websites aren't homogeneous - I don't know that your average reader would know the difference between BuzzFeed and BuzzFeed News, for example.
